Kharkiv Region Under Fire: Battles Continue as Russian Forces Press Attacks

Kharkiv, Ukraine – Intense fighting continues in the Kharkiv region of Ukraine, as Russian forces maintain their offensive operations. Recent reports indicate ongoing clashes in multiple areas, alongside a concerning incident of a scheme to avoid military conscription and the aftermath of Russian strikes on civilian infrastructure.

Ongoing Battles and Russian Offensive Efforts

The General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ine reported that over the past 24 hours, 16 battles occurred in the Kharkiv region. Russian forces attempted to break through Ukrainian defenses 12 times in the Yuzhno-Slobozhansky direction, specifically near Veterinary, Zeleny, Staritsa, Volchansk, Vilcha, Okhrimovka, Zarubinka and Chugunovka. In the Kupyansk direction, four attacks were launched in the areas of Kondrashovka, Petropavlivka, Kurilovka, and Novoosinovo.

237 military clashes were recorded across Ukraine in the last 24 hours, including one missile strike, 61 air strikes, 196 guided bombs, 4,748 kamikaze drones, and 2,453 artillery shellings of populated areas and Ukrainian troop positions, with 76 of those shellings coming from multiple launch rocket systems.

Fighting is particularly concentrated in the Lyptsi and Vovchansk directions, with Russian forces deploying infantry and heavy equipment. Combat is ongoing in three locations within Vovchansk as of February 20, 2026.

Civilian Impact and Infrastructure Damage

A Russian missile strike hit the Slobodsky district of Kharkiv on the morning of February 20, 2026, damaging administrative buildings, vehicles, and breaking windows in residential buildings. Preliminary reports indicate the use of an Iskander-M missile.

Elsewhere in the region, a 68-year-aged woman was injured by a drone strike near the village of Bezruki, sustaining injuries to her hip. A fire at a UAV enterprise in the Malinovskaya community resulted in one fatality and two injuries. Approximately 3,000 square meters of warehouse space were destroyed.

A fire in the village of Dvurechny Kut, caused by Russian shelling, resulted in the death of approximately 100 pigs and injuries to a local man born in 1967.

Scheme to Evade Military Service Uncovered

Ukrainian security services have uncovered a scheme in Kharkiv involving fictitious teachers being registered to allow individuals to avoid military conscription. Officials from a private security training enterprise allegedly registered men as teachers for a fee, providing them with deferments. The scheme involved an initial payment of $3,000, followed by $500 every six months for continued “cooperation.” Three individuals have been charged in connection with the scheme.

Regional Demographic Trends

Data indicates that marriages in Ukraine increased by 10% in 2025, while divorces decreased by 12%, resulting in a ratio of seven divorces for every ten marriages. The Kyiv, Dnipropetrovsk, and Lviv regions saw increases in marriages. In the Kharkiv region, 8,358 marriages were registered in 2025.
